如何为FTP服务器配置SSL以增强数据传输安全性?

FTP服务器SSL配置详解

在当今网络环境中,数据传输的安全性至关重要,FTP(文件传输协议)作为一种常见的文件传输方式,其明文传输的特性使得数据在传输过程中面临被窃取或篡改的风险,为了解决这一问题,FTP服务器可以结合SSL(安全套接层)协议,实现加密传输,从而保障数据传输的安全性,本文将详细介绍如何在FTP服务器上配置SSL,包括所需步骤、注意事项以及常见问题解答。

ftp 服务器 ssl

一、引言

随着网络安全意识的提高,越来越多的企业和个人开始重视数据传输的安全性,FTP作为传统的文件传输协议,因其简单易用而广泛应用,但其明文传输方式存在严重的安全隐患,通过引入SSL协议,FTP服务器可以实现数据的加密传输,有效防止数据泄露和篡改。

二、FTP服务器SSL配置步骤

1、选择合适的FTP服务器软件:确保所选的FTP服务器软件支持SSL/TLS功能,市面上有多种FTP服务器软件可供选择,如FileZilla Server、ProFTPD、Pure-FTPd等,这些软件在配置SSL/TLS时可能略有不同,但基本步骤相似。

2、申请并安装SSL证书:SSL证书是实现FTP服务器SSL加密的关键,您可以从权威的证书颁发机构(CA)购买证书,也可以使用自签名证书进行测试,自签名证书虽然免费,但可能在客户端引起不信任的提示,建议生产环境使用由CA签发的证书,申请到证书后,需要将其安装到FTP服务器上,并配置相应的路径。

3、配置FTP服务器以启用SSL/TLS:编辑FTP服务器的配置文件(如proftpd.conf或pure-ftpd.conf),找到与SSL/TLS相关的设置项,启用SSL/TLS选项,并指定证书和密钥的路径,还需要配置FTP服务器监听正确的端口(默认为990)。

4、重启FTP服务:保存配置文件更改后,需要重启FTP服务以使更改生效,具体的重启命令可能因操作系统和FTP服务器软件的不同而有所差异。

ftp 服务器 ssl

5、配置客户端以支持SSL/TLS:大多数现代FTP客户端都支持SSL/TLS连接,在客户端设置中,找到SSL/TLS相关的选项,并启用它,确保客户端配置为连接到FTP服务器的SSL/TLS端口。

6、测试SSL连接:使用支持SSL的FTP客户端工具(如FileZilla)连接到FTP服务器,并尝试进行文件传输操作,检查连接是否成功建立,并验证数据传输过程中是否加密。

三、注意事项

保持证书更新:SSL证书具有一定的有效期,过期的证书会导致服务中断,定期检查并更新SSL证书至关重要。

性能评估:启用SSL/TLS会增加服务器的CPU负担,因此在配置前应对服务器性能进行评估,以确保能够满足业务需求。

安全审计:定期审查FTP服务器的安全设置和用户活动日志,及时发现并处理潜在的安全威胁。

四、常见问题解答

ftp 服务器 ssl

Q1: SSL证书对FTP服务器有什么作用?

A1: SSL证书用于加密FTP传输中的数据,防止数据被未经授权的第三方访问或篡改,它通过验证服务器身份,确保客户端与预期的服务器进行通信,从而保护数据传输的安全性。

Q2: 如何在FTP服务器上安装SSL证书?

A2: 从权威的证书颁发机构(CA)购买或申请一个SSL证书,将证书文件和私钥文件安装到FTP服务器的正确目录中,在FTP服务器的配置文件中指定证书和密钥的路径,并启用SSL/TLS选项,重启FTP服务以使配置生效。

Q3: 如何测试FTP服务器的SSL连接是否正常工作?

A3: 使用支持SSL的FTP客户端工具(如FileZilla)连接到FTP服务器的SSL/TLS端口(默认为990),尝试进行文件上传和下载操作,检查连接是否成功建立并验证数据传输过程中是否加密,如果一切正常,那么SSL连接就已经成功配置并正常工作了。

通过以上步骤和注意事项的介绍,相信您已经掌握了如何在FTP服务器上配置SSL的方法,在实际应用中,请根据您的具体环境和需求进行调整和优化,定期关注网络安全动态和技术发展,及时更新和维护您的FTP服务器以确保数据传输的安全性。

小伙伴们,上文介绍了“ftp 服务器 ssl”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/751252.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-12-20 21:55
Next 2024-12-20 22:00

相关推荐

  • 为何FTP服务器不支持非ASCII字符?

    FTP服务器不支持非 ASCII 字符详解一、概述在文件传输协议(FTP)的使用过程中,有时会遇到“服务器不支持非 ASCII 字符”的问题,这通常意味着 FTP 服务器只支持 ASCII 字符集,而无法正确处理包含非 ASCII 字符的文件名或目录名,本文将详细探讨这一问题的原因、影响及解决方案,二、原因分析……

    2024-12-20
    00
  • 如何获取FTP主机的IP地址?

    如何查看FTP主机的IP地址要查看本机FTP服务器的IP地址,可以通过以下几种方法进行操作,这些方法适用于Windows和Mac操作系统,并且不需要额外的软件工具,下面将详细介绍每种方法的具体步骤:使用命令提示符或终端1、打开命令提示符(Windows):按下Win + R键,输入“cmd”并按下回车键,2、打……

    2024-12-20
    01
  • FTP 服务器通常会占用多少内存?

    FTP服务器的内存占用是一个复杂且多因素决定的问题,它受到系统负载、FTP服务软件、操作系统、文件缓存以及其他运行进程的影响,下面将详细分析这些影响因素:1、系统负载并发连接数:FTP服务器所能处理的并发连接数对内存需求有直接影响,每个连接都需要一定的内存来处理请求和维护会话状态,如果服务器需要处理大量并发连接……

    2024-12-17
    05
  • FTP 服务器上传文件时遇到错误,该如何解决?

    FTP服务器上传文件错误可能涉及多个方面,包括连接问题、权限问题、服务器配置问题等,以下是对这些问题的详细分析以及相应的解决方法:一、常见FTP服务器上传文件错误及解决方法1、连接被拒绝或超时原因:FTP服务器地址或端口号输入错误;网络连接不稳定或中断,解决方法:确认FTP服务器的地址和端口号正确无误;检查网络……

    2024-12-20
    04
  • FTP 服务器为何支持长链接?探究其背后的原因与优势

    FTP服务器允许长链接概述在现代网络环境中,文件传输协议(FTP)作为一种常用的文件传输工具,广泛应用于各种场景,FTP连接默认的超时设置可能导致长时间未操作的连接被中断,从而影响用户体验和数据传输效率,本文将详细介绍如何配置FTP服务器以支持长链接,并探讨相关的技术细节和注意事项,配置FTP服务器的长链接1……

    2024-12-17
    01
  • 如何在本地Linux主机上启动FTP服务器并上传文件到Linux云服务器?

    要在本地Linux主机上启动FTP服务器,首先需要安装vsftpd。在Ubuntu或Debian系统上,可以使用以下命令安装:,,``bash,sudo aptget update,sudo aptget install vsftpd,`,,安装完成后,启动vsftpd服务:,,`bash,sudo systemctl start vsftpd,`,,要上传文件到云服务器,可以使用ftp命令。,,`bash,ftp 用户名@云服务器IP地址,`,,然后输入密码,使用put命令上传文件:,,`bash,put 本地文件路径 云服务器目标路径,``

    2024-07-30
    080

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入